The Moon 6ty catamaran is a fusion of unparalleled luxury, precise technology, and elegance. Designed for the most discerning clients seeking not only unforgettable adventures on the water but also ultimate comfort and prestige. The MOON 6ty is a premium yacht that combines exceptional sailing performance with a modern, sophisticated design, offering the choice between a sailing and motor version.

The interior of the MOON 6ty is a true feast for the senses—spacious, modern, and fully tailored to the owner's individual preferences. The selection of materials, including natural stone, sintered surfaces, and elegant upholstery, ensures that every part of the yacht forms a cohesive, luxurious whole. Thoughtful spatial arrangement, with attention to every detail, makes the MOON 6ty the perfect space for top-tier relaxation, where each element is unique and designed with passion.

The exterior deck of the MOON 6ty is a space designed to satisfy every luxury lifestyle enthusiast. In the main aft cockpit, perfectly sheltered from the wind, you can unwind in the "al fresco" lounge area or relax on the comfortable sofa. This space seamlessly blends elegance with functionality—from the hydraulically extendable gangway to the wide swim platforms that create a true beach club on the water, perfect for enjoying water toys or soaking up the sun.

The MOON 60 flybridge is where elegance, spaciousness, and cutting-edge technology come together to create the perfect setting for both sailing and relaxation. A panoramic 360-degree view, plush seating, a bar, and a jacuzzi make this a place where luxury meets nature. It is also the yacht’s command center—equipped with modern navigation devices and control systems, allowing for effortless maneuvering and a seamless sailing experience.

Advanced technology – precision and comfort

The sailing version of the MOON 6ty features an innovative sail management system. All lines required for sail handling are led to a single location at the helm station, ensuring ease of use and convenience. This allows the entire crew to enjoy a comfortable sailing experience without worrying about complex maneuvers while maintaining a sense of space and tranquility on board. The MOON 6ty is a catamaran that seamlessly blends advanced technology with timeless luxury, designed to meet the needs of the modern sailor.

Rate Notes & Conditions

Relocations

Non-Commissionable and subject to availability.

  • St. Thomas/St John: $750 each way ($1,500 round trip).
  • St. Martin/St Barts/Anguilla: $5,000 relocation fee + 72-hour turnaround required before/after charter.
  • Windward Islands: Inquire for availability and a relocation fee quote.

Charter Details

  • Guest Maximum: 10 pax. 5 queen en-suite cabins.
  • Turnaround: 72 hours (24 or 48 hours upon request)
  • Embark/Disembark: 12:00 PM / 12:00 PM
  • 6 Night Rate: (Weekly rate ÷ 7) × 6 | 5 Night Rate: (Weekly rate ÷ 6) × number of nights

Sleep Aboard

Commissionable if not discounted

  • Rate: ½ of applicable daily rate (Daily Rate: 6+ nights = weekly ÷ 7 | 5 nights or less = weekly ÷ 6)
  • Boarding after 4:00 PM, welcome cocktail, breakfast onboard, early departure
  • Dinner is ashore at charterer's expense

Half Board & Local Fare

  • Half Board: -$150 per person (7 breakfasts, 4 lunches, 3 dinners). Remaining meals ashore at charterer's expense.
  • Local Fare: -$105 per person (7 breakfasts, 5 lunches, 6 dinners). Remaining meals ashore at charterer's expense.

Discounts

Pro-rated for charters under 7 nights.

Children under 12: -$100 per child | Infants: -$500 per infant

Holiday Rates (2026)

  • Christmas: 7-night minimum | $62,000 (2-10 guests) | Must end by Dec. 26
  • New Year's: 7-night minimum | $80,000 (2-10 guests) | Must start Dec. 28 or later

My wife and I spent a week on the Moon Shadow for our 25th anniversary, hopping across the BVIs. It was a magical experience. The boat was luxurious and quiet. Captain Grant took us to amazing locations we hadn’t seen even though we have been to the islands so many times. First mate Juan took care of our every need and Chef Ashleigh fixed delicious meals with such a personalized touch. A memorable week!
